/* Bootstrap Icons subset — embedded as CSS classes with Unicode */
@font-face{
  font-family:"bootstrap-icons";
  src:url("https://cdn.jsdelivr.net/npm/bootstrap-icons@1.11.3/font/fonts/bootstrap-icons.woff2") format("woff2"),
      url("https://cdn.jsdelivr.net/npm/bootstrap-icons@1.11.3/font/fonts/bootstrap-icons.woff") format("woff");
  font-display:swap
}
.bi::before,[class^="bi-"]::before,[class*=" bi-"]::before{
  display:inline-block;font-family:"bootstrap-icons"!important;
  font-style:normal;font-weight:400!important;font-variant:normal;
  text-transform:none;line-height:1;vertical-align:-.125em;
  -web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ale
}
/* Icon codes yang dipakai */
.bi-envelope-fill::before{content:"\f32f"}
.bi-telephone-fill::before{content:"\f5d6"}
.bi-instagram::before{content:"\f437"}
.bi-facebook::before{content:"\f344"}
.bi-youtube::before{content:"\f62d"}
.bi-whatsapp::before{content:"\f618"}
.bi-person-circle::before{content:"\f4da"}
.bi-lock-fill::before{content:"\f47d"}
.bi-chevron-right::before{content:"\f285"}
.bi-chevron-down::before{content:"\f282"}
.bi-chevron-up::before{content:"\f286"}
.bi-megaphone-fill::before{content:"\f497"}
.bi-moon-stars-fill::before{content:"\f498"}
.bi-star-fill::before{content:"\f588"}
.bi-quote::before{content:"\f6b0"}
.bi-arrow-right::before{content:"\f138"}
.bi-arrow-left::before{content:"\f12c"}
.bi-book::before{content:"\f1e2"}
.bi-book-fill::before{content:"\f1e3"}
.bi-book-half::before{content:"\f1e4"}
.bi-eye::before{content:"\f341"}
.bi-eye-fill::before{content:"\f342"}
.bi-diagram-3::before{content:"\f318"}
.bi-diagram-3-fill::before{content:"\f319"}
.bi-list-check::before{content:"\f470"}
.bi-building::before{content:"\f1df"}
.bi-building-check::before{content:"\f1de"}
.bi-people-fill::before{content:"\f4cf"}
.bi-person-hearts::before{content:"\f4e6"}
.bi-person-standing-dress::before{content:"\f91e"}
.bi-mortarboard::before{content:"\f49b"}
.bi-mortarboard-fill::before{content:"\f49c"}
.bi-images-fill::before{content:"\f433"}
.bi-images::before{content:"\f432"}
.bi-download-fill::before{content:"\f2d4"}
.bi-calendar-event-fill::before{content:"\f1f1"}
.bi-calendar-event::before{content:"\f1f0"}
.bi-calendar3::before{content:"\f1f9"}
.bi-calendar-check::before{content:"\f1ed"}
.bi-heart-fill::before{content:"\f415"}
.bi-heart-pulse::before{content:"\f417"}
.bi-newspaper::before{content:"\f4b5"}
.bi-geo-alt-fill::before{content:"\f3ef"}
.bi-patch-check-fill::before{content:"\f4c7"}
.bi-info-circle::before{content:"\f431"}
.bi-globe::before{content:"\f3f0"}
.bi-link-45deg::before{content:"\f471"}
.bi-speedometer2::before{content:"\f574"}
.bi-gear-fill::before{content:"\f3e1"}
.bi-image::before{content:"\f432"}
.bi-play-btn-fill::before{content:"\f4f7"}
.bi-collection-fill::before{content:"\f267"}
.bi-collection-play-fill::before{content:"\f269"}
.bi-cloud-download-fill::before{content:"\f27a"}
.bi-file-earmark-text-fill::before{content:"\f30c"}
.bi-layout-text-window-reverse::before{content:"\f45a"}
.bi-trophy-fill::before{content:"\f5db"}
.bi-stars::before{content:"\f58a"}
.bi-person-workspace::before{content:"\f4fa"}
.bi-box-arrow-up-right::before{content:"\f1c9"}
.bi-box-arrow-left::before{content:"\f1c1"}
.bi-person-badge::before{content:"\f4d2"}
.bi-send::before{content:"\f549"}
.bi-check-circle::before{content:"\f26b"}
.bi-exclamation-circle::before{content:"\f332"}
.bi-bar-chart-fill::before{content:"\f1a7"}
.bi-pie-chart-fill::before{content:"\f4e2"}
.bi-plus-lg::before{content:"\f64d"}
.bi-pencil::before{content:"\f4ca"}
.bi-trash::before{content:"\f5de"}
.bi-search::before{content:"\f52a"}
.bi-x-lg::before{content:"\f659"}
.bi-check-lg::before{content:"\f26b"}
.bi-three-dots::before{content:"\f5cd"}
.bi-upload::before{content:"\f60c"}
.bi-eye-slash::before{content:"\f344"}
.bi-filter::before{content:"\f35a"}
